Berry Jam Made with Chia Seeds
Ingredients
- 1 cup fresh berries
- 1 tablespoon chia seeds
Preparation
Put the berries into a small sauce pot and heat while mashing with a heavy spoon, ladle, or potato masher.
Once the mixture starts to simmer and is broken down, stir in the chia seeds.
Turn off the heat and transfer to a glass dish or jar to cool.
It will thicken into a jam consistency within half an hour. Refrigerate for even thicker results.
Tips
You can use frozen berries or fresh, depending on availability.
This jam can be made with equal parts blueberry, raspberry, and strawberry, or any single type of berry.
Using chia seeds eliminates the need for sugar, adds fiber, and provides essential Omega-3 fatty acids.
